AJAX(Asynchronous JavaScript and XML)是一种在Web应用程序中实现异步交互的技术,J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,常用于服务器和Web应用程序之间的数据传输。
$.ajax({
url: "getData.PHP",type: "GET",dataType: "json",success: function(data) {
// 在此处处理获取到的JSON数据
}
});
上述示例代码展示了使用jQuery的AJAX方法从名为getData.PHP的服务器端代码获取JSON数据的过程。
使用Ajax JSON进行增删改查操作的方式如下:
1. 增加数据
$.ajax({
url: "addData.PHP",type: "POST",data: {
name: "John",age: 30
},success: function(data) {
// 在此处处理添加数据后返回的JSON数据
}
});
上述示例代码展示了使用Ajax JSON向addData.PHP服务器端代码添加名为"John"和年龄为30的新数据的过程。
2. 删除数据
$.ajax({
url: "deleteData.PHP",data: { id: 10 },success: function(data) {
// 在此处处理删除数据后返回的JSON数据
}
});
上述示例代码展示了使用Ajax JSON从deleteData.PHP服务器端代码删除ID为10的数据的过程。
3. 更新数据
$.ajax({
url: "updateData.PHP",data: {
id: 10,name: "Smith",age: 25
},success: function(data) {
// 在此处处理更新数据后返回的JSON数据
}
});
上述示例代码展示了使用Ajax JSON向updateData.PHP服务器端代码更新ID为10的记录的过程。
4. 查询数据
$.ajax({
url: "queryData.PHP",success: function(data) {
// 在此处处理查询数据后返回的JSON数据
}
});
上述示例代码展示了使用Ajax JSON从queryData.PHP服务器端代码获取所有记录的过程以供查询。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 [email protected] 举报,一经查实,本站将立刻删除。